Up to 25% Your Job Georgia-Pacific is seeking an Executive Assistant to support the Corporate Projects & Engineering Group. In this role, you will be a critical partner to leadership, enabling team effectiveness through proactive executive support, with additional responsibilities for office coordination and operational processes. You will work closely with leadership and team members to ensure smooth day-to-day operations, strong communication, and effective coordination across an organization of 400+ employees. This role requires a highly organized, detail-oriented individual who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ment. Our Team Our team is composed of individuals with diverse backgrounds across the Georgia-Pacific organization. The Projects and Engineering team partners with manufacturing facilities and external stakeholders to deliver capital projects across the United States. As Executive Assistant, you are a key enabler of this work-supporting leaders and teams by managing executive priorities, coordinating activities, and ensuring processes run efficiently to support our success. What You Will Do Executive & Team Support (Primary Responsibilities)
- Manage calendars, travel arrangements, and priorities for leadership
- Develop, format, and organize presentations and key documents
- Coordinate onsite and offsite meetings, key programs, team events, and leadership offsites
- Provide comprehensive administrative support to leaders, supervisors, and the broader team
- Manage confidential information with discretion and professionalism Onboarding, Transfers & Offboarding
- Facilitate onboarding for employees and contractors, ensuring a smooth and professional experience
- Coordinate system access, equipment, training requirements, and team integration activities
- Manage transfer and offboarding processes, including return of assets and system updates Systems, Technology & Resource Coordination
- Act as the primary point of contact for hardware, software, and access requests
- SharePoint sites growth and strategy and support document management and knowledge sharing
- Coordinate training assignments and track completion through Learning Management Systems
- Partner with IT and internal stakeholders to ensure employees have the tools and access they need
- Serve as a key resource for SharePoint, Records & Information Management (RIM Compliance), and Learning Management System Office Management & Administrative Support (Additional Responsibilities)
- Manage office logistics including supplies, equipment, mail, and visitor coordination
